About this listen
When we left Alexis and the crew, lives were hanging in the balance and their enemies were celebrating their victories. Old relationships were strained, and new ones started to form. But they were quickly threatened by danger and drama from jealous exes and bitter enemies bent on revenge.
Will Alexis and Kevell be able to survive and come to the rescue of their loved ones who need them the most? Or will the losses and damage their enemies have inflicted be too much for them to handle?
Find out if the crew comes out with their loves, lives, and freedom intact in this drama-filled finale.
